Development Lorenz Van de Wynkele second in opening stage of Olympia's Tour

Lorenz Van de Wynkele finished an impressive second today in the opening stage of the Olympia's Tour.
Race 20 March 2024

As poorly as the race started for Lorenz Van de Wynkele, it ended just as well. Van de Wynkele took a heavy crash in the beginning of the 145-kilometer stage from and to Medemblik. "A few of us went down on a speed bump that wasn't marked," Van de Wynkele said. "I ended up with abrasions, but my bike was completely wrecked. It was really a nasty crash."

Despite the setback, Van de Wynkele was able to continue fueled by adrenaline to ultimately finish second. "About fifteen kilometers from the finish, three of us broke away - me, along with a rider from Metec-Solarwatt and one from Lidl-Trek. Towards the end, a rider from VolkerWessels joined us and immediately attacked. I hesitated for too long and reacted too late. It's a shame because I truly believe the victory was within reach. I can't really hide my disappointment."

However, there are still opportunities in the coming days. "We have more similar stages ahead like today's. Flat and with potential crosswinds. I'm especially hoping for some extra wind, then we can still achieve some great results here."
